He sat on the street bench aiming at the next act of wickedness and depravity. Tangled up in all that had gone by, each action seemed like digging a deeper grave and called for a stronger pull. All the sex and the drugs, “I give up and I’m not even trying again” he said to himself
“No one believes I can be good, everyone would even laugh at a though of me being good, even I . . . So what’s the point?” 

That was when he made up his mind to travel down the wide road. Five years later, he’s a pimp and a hustler. He’s rising as the second best party-club manager in his community.
But five years later could have been different. He could have been whole and holy if he only gave up the dirty laundry he kept wearing which he called designers.
